yum源挂载

挂在yum源之前我们要查看hostnamectl 查看电脑版本,镜像与版本相同。

挂载类型 emptyDir 方式 hostPath 方式 挂载yum_通过yum源安装软件

1.永久yum源挂载

简单挂载(如我博客:通过镜像搭建本地yum源)重启后yum源会丢失,需要重新挂载。为使我们的操作更加简便,我们可以搭建永久yum源挂载。

(1)首先,我们要给虚拟机添加镜像的光驱。

挂载类型 emptyDir 方式 hostPath 方式 挂载yum_通过yum源安装软件_02


挂载类型 emptyDir 方式 hostPath 方式 挂载yum_yum源的永久搭建_03


(2)我们要通过df命令查看挂载点。

挂载类型 emptyDir 方式 hostPath 方式 挂载yum_共享yum源的搭建_04


(3)创建一个文件,将yum 源挂载到此文件

挂载类型 emptyDir 方式 hostPath 方式 挂载yum_通过yum源安装软件_05


(4)编写yum源指定文件,注意:再此目录下文件必须是repo类型

挂载类型 emptyDir 方式 hostPath 方式 挂载yum_通过yum源安装软件_06


挂载类型 emptyDir 方式 hostPath 方式 挂载yum_yum源_07


(5)编写/etc/rc.d/rc.local文件,添加执行权限

挂载类型 emptyDir 方式 hostPath 方式 挂载yum_yum源的永久搭建_08


挂载类型 emptyDir 方式 hostPath 方式 挂载yum_共享yum源的搭建_09


重启虚拟机后yum源挂载依然在。

挂载类型 emptyDir 方式 hostPath 方式 挂载yum_共享yum源的搭建_10


mount 挂载

umount  卸下挂载

挂载类型 emptyDir 方式 hostPath 方式 挂载yum_yum命令的各种用法_11

在上面的操作中如果我们在/etc/yum.repo.d/目录下有多个文件,我们可以不删除已经存在的yum源文件,通过注释repo文件,使只有我们新建的文件生效。

挂载类型 emptyDir 方式 hostPath 方式 挂载yum_yum源的永久搭建_12


挂载类型 emptyDir 方式 hostPath 方式 挂载yum_yum源_13


enabled=0 注释repo文件

gpgcheck=0 是否检查软件包的授权性,0为不检查

2.共享性yum源的部署

  • 前提:此操作的前提时我们要在虚拟机中已经下载好httpd。搭建好本地yum源后就可以下载。
  • 操作

    在/var/www/html/目录下创建一个文件,将yum源挂载进去。

    在/etc/yum.repos.d/目录下创建一个repo类型的文件;再编辑/etc/rc.d/rc.local文件,对共享性yum源进行永久设置。


    设置永久挂载。
  • 测试:
    在浏览器中输入地址:
    http://ip/filehttp://172.25.55.1/westos 此地址就是网络yum源地址

3.yum各种用法

命令

含义

yum  clean all

清除原有yum缓存

yum  repolist

列出仓库信息

yum install software

安装软件

yum update

更新

yum list  software

查看软件

yum list  all

查看所有软件

yum list  installed

列出已安装软件

yum list  available

列出可安装软件

yum reinstall software

重新安装

yum remove  software

卸载

yum info  software

查看软件信息

yum search software信息

根据软件信息查找软件

yum whatprovides  file

根据文件找出包含此文件的软件

yum groups  list

列出软件组

yum groups info

查看软件组的信息

yum group install  sfgroup

安装软件组

yum group remove  sfgroup

卸载软件组

挂载类型 emptyDir 方式 hostPath 方式 挂载yum_yum命令的各种用法_14


挂载类型 emptyDir 方式 hostPath 方式 挂载yum_yum命令的各种用法_15